Panola is a one of the reprobates as are most of them in Louisiana. However,
marketing is what it's all about. We use a couple of firms to produce some
private label stuff for us, and one of them has more than 30 companies using
around 10 sauces for well over 45 products. 

Think about private label veggies, soups or pet food in your grocery store.
Chances are if it says Meijer or Wal-Mart it was most like produced by Del
Monte or Heinz-Kerry - same stuff different label.
